Tiltable rotating construction laser with a grade mechanism and method for determining a position of a grade arm of the grade mechanism

摘要

Rotating construction laser device (28) with a grade mechanism (1), comprising a lens barrel (21) in which a laser optical system (20) is disposed; a frame structure (8) that is fixed to, integrated into or directly provided by a part of the structure of the lens barrel (21); a grade arm (2), which is tiltably supported on the frame structure (8) in an XZ-plane; a tilt sensor (10) which is provided at the grade arm (2) and is configured to detect a level position of the grade arm (2); a tilting mechanism (22), which is provided on the frame structure (8) and is designed to tilt the grade arm (2) relative to the XZ-plane; a position detection device for detecting a feedback position information; and a levelling mechanism (23), which supports the lens barrel (21) tiltably and is designed to tilt the lens barrel (21) in order to have the level position detected by the tilt sensor (10) and therewith to level the grade arm (2), characterised in that the position detection device is configured to detect a feedback position information, which directly depends on the position of a reference point on the grade arm (2), thus allowing to deduce a position of the grade arm (2) directly from the feedback position information, and/or to calculate a tilting angle (β, β1) of the grade arm (2) with respect to the lens barrel (21) directly from the feedback position information.
